Course Content

• Play-Based Learning Theories and Pedagogies
• Creative Expression through Play: Art, Music, and Movement
• Designing and Implementing Play-Based Learning Environments
• Assessment and Documentation in Play-Based Learning
• Child Development and Play: Cognitive, Social, and Emotional Growth
• Inclusive Play: Supporting Diverse Learners in Play-Based Settings
• Play-Based Learning and Literacy Development
• The Power of Nature in Play-Based Learning (Outdoor Play)
• Digital Technologies and Play-Based Learning

Career path

Career Role Description
Play-Based Learning Specialist Develops and implements engaging play-based learning programs for children, aligning with early years frameworks. High demand in nurseries and schools.
Creative Play Therapist Uses creative play techniques to support children's emotional and social development. Growing demand in mental health and educational settings.
Early Years Educator (Play-Based) Focuses on play-based pedagogy in early years settings, fostering creativity and holistic development. A core role with consistent high demand.
Playwork Practitioner Designs and facilitates creative play opportunities for children and young people in various settings, including play schemes and community centers.
Educational Consultant (Play-Based Learning) Provides expertise and guidance to schools and organizations on implementing effective play-based learning strategies. Increasing demand in the education sector.
